WORK DESCRIPTION: This job requires daily travel to structures that are in all phases of construction. Essential duties include technical work in listing and assessing buildings and/or land to accurately reflect true market value. Documenting field measurements, determining grade of materials/quality of workmanship and entering information into tax appraisal software are key elements for this position. Must use independent judgement and be a self-starter. Work may subject employee to inside and outside environments and hazards. Excellent people skills are required in dealing with taxpayers who may not agree with property assessments. Ability to establish and maintain effective working relationships with co-workers, other departments and the public are a must.
MINIMUM TRAINING AND EXPERIENCE: Must have a high school diploma or GED and education equivalent to one year of college. Must possess a valid driver’s license and must obtain certification by the State of North Carolina as a County Real Property Appraiser within 1 year of employment. Employee shall during the first year of employment and at least every other year thereafter attend a course of instruction in his/her area of work. At the end of the first year of their employment, employee shall also achieve a passing score on a comprehensive examination in property tax administration conducted by the North Carolina Department of Revenue.
